Description

As the Student Activities Coordinator, you will be responsible for establishing a comprehensive student life framework for programming across the College that meets the needs of students, so they can participate in positive campus life experiences. The Student Activities Coordinator is responsible to enhance the growth and development of all students by providing social, cultural, recreational, and educational opportunities for all students to engage with the campus and the community.
Essential Job Functions
Key responsibilities and duties may include, but are not limited to, the following:
Plan and organize recreational and cultural opportunities, both on and off campus, to provide varied options for student participation.

Ensure that those programs are organized and executed at a high professional level with appropriate adult supervision and consistent student participation.

Ensure that program offerings are adequately planned, equipped and supervised.
Work closely with Houseparents to ensure and increase student involvement in the organized groups.
Develop student leadership skills through the Student Representative Council, and Student Leadership Conventions.
Promotes, organizes, schedules and supervises and oversee an intramural sports program.
Organize and promote student-organized groups which develop community involvement such as Students Against Drunk Driving, Relay for Life and the Terry Fox run.
Plan and organize special events for the students on and off-campus such as 3-4 dances per school year, Grade 12 Leadership Day, Turnaround Day, and Alumni Weekend Fun Day.
Develop annual and long-range plans for student activities, as well as submitting a monthly calendar of events.
Develop and submit budgets for activities.
Fundraise with students for extra resources.
